- Cause of death was Quinsey, an abscess between the back of the tonsil and the wall of the throat. William died at the age of 57 years. William was born in Belfast, and resided at 63 Great Georges Street.

Buried at Clifton Street Cemetery, City of Belfast. Graves in lower grounds, Lot C 48-49. [Formerly large pedimented monument with centre tablet in arched recess and two slate tablets on each side, now all laid flat in the ground]. Samuel Bruce Vance, died 1 January 1850, platform 'C', grave number 48. Erected by William Vance, in memory of his four children who died in infancy [Left- hand tablet]; William Vance died 5 October 1855 aged 56 years; Jane Martin, his wife died 9th March 1860 aged 57 years [Right -hand tablet] Also their daughter Jane Martin Vance, died 5th January 1911; Also Annie Vance, born May 1836, died Jan 1925. Graves purchased by William Vance in December 1949, grave 48, and grave 49 in April 1850.
